America's Most Popular Professional Sports Leagues in 2024: NFL, NBA, MLB, NHL, NCAA, MLS, WNBA, and MMA



Sports in America act as a reflection of the country's varied interests and the ever-evolving dynamics of fandom. In 2024, the landscape of professional sports is as vibrant as ever, with leagues like the NFL, NBA, MLB, NHL, NCAA, MLS, WNBA, and MMA capturing the hearts and minds of millions. This article will delve deep into the existing status of these leagues, exploring their appeal, financial impact, and cultural significance.

NFL: The Titan of American Sports

The National Football League (NFL) remains the most popular and economically dominant sports league in the United States in 2024. With 65% of Americans determining as NFL fans, the league delights in a fanbase that spans all demographics. The NFL's dominance is likewise shown in its income, which is forecasted to reach $17 billion, driven by colossal tv agreements, sponsorship deals, and product sales.

Secret Highlights

Viewership: NFL games attract an average of 16.6 million viewers per video game, making it the most-watched league in the nation.
Television Contracts: The league's broadcasting rights handles significant networks like CBS, NBC, ESPN, and Fox contribute considerably to its income, totaling around $9 billion annually.
Cultural Impact: The Super Bowl continues to be the single most considerable sports event in America, drawing over 100 million viewers and commanding millions in marketing revenue.

NBA: A Global Powerhouse with a Strong Domestic Base

The National Basketball Association (NBA) stays a cultural and global force, with 51% of Americans recognizing as fans. The NBA has actually successfully broadened its influence beyond American borders, turning into one of the most recognized sports leagues worldwide. In 2024, the NBA's revenue is forecasted to be around $8.8 billion 9 † source 10 † source.

Key Highlights

Star Power: The NBA's marketing is heavily centered around its star players, who are not simply athletes but worldwide icons. Gamers like LeBron James and Stephen Curry continue to drive the league's appeal.
International Reach: The NBA's international strategy, which includes preseason video games abroad and the recruitment of global stars, has widened its fanbase considerably.
Digital and Social Media: The NBA is a leader in digital engagement, leveraging social networks platforms to connect with younger audiences worldwide.

MLB: Preserving Tradition in a Changing World

Major League Baseball (MLB), referred to as America's activity, continues to hold a considerable location in the sports hierarchy. In 2024, MLB deals with difficulties in preserving its interest younger audiences, however it still commands a faithful following, with 42% of Americans recognizing as fans.

Key Highlights

Profits: MLB's earnings is expected to reach $10.7 billion, boosted by extensive regional broadcasting offers and the sport's traditional appeal.
Viewership Trends: While total viewership has actually declined somewhat, MLB's regional sports networks still bring in a big audience, particularly in baseball's historical markets.
Innovation and Rule Changes: In action to criticisms about the rate of the game, MLB has actually executed guideline changes, such as the intro of pitch clocks, aimed at making video games faster and more appealing.

NHL: Expanding its Frozen Footprint

The National Hockey League (NHL) has seen steady development in popularity, specifically in regions with chillier environments where hockey has deep roots. In 2024, the NHL enjoys a devoted following, with 20% of Americans recognizing as fans.

Key Highlights

Profits: The NHL's income is anticipated to be around $5.1 billion, driven by its regional loyalty and increasing digital existence.
Viewership: The NHL has actually benefited from its broadcast handle ESPN and TNT, which have actually helped increase the league's exposure and bring in new fans.
Cultural Significance: The NHL's outdoor video games, such as the Winter Classic, have actually ended up being popular events, drawing considerable crowds and tv ratings.

NCAA: College Sports as a Cultural Pillar

College sports, governed by the NCAA (National Collegiate Athletic Association), continue to play a crucial function in American sports culture. With 30% of Americans identifying as college football fans and 25% as college basketball fans, the NCAA remains extremely prominent 10 † Click here source.

Secret Highlights

Income and Viewership: Major college sports, especially football and basketball, create billions in earnings each year, with events like the College Football Playoff and March Madness drawing massive viewership.
Regional Loyalty: College sports frequently promote extreme regional rivalries and deep-rooted traditions, making them some of the most passionately followed sports in the nation.
Athlete Advocacy: The NCAA has seen increased attention on issues related to athlete compensation and rights, which continues to form the future of college sports.

MLS: The Rising Star of American Sports

Big League Soccer (MLS) has actually been on a growth trajectory, although it still lags behind the traditional "Big Four" leagues in regards to total appeal. In 2024, 12% of Americans determine as MLS fans, reflecting the sport's steady rise in the U.S.

Key Highlights

Profits Growth: MLS's revenue is approximated at $2 billion, with a significant increase from its broadcasting deal with Apple TV, which brings in $250 million every year.
Youth Engagement: Soccer is increasingly popular among more youthful generations, which bodes well for MLS's future development.
International Influence: The recruitment of prominent international gamers has raised the league's profile and assisted bring in a more diverse fanbase.

WNBA: Pioneering Women's Sports

The Women's National Basketball Association (WNBA) has been acquiring momentum, with 12% of Americans supporting the league. In 2024, the WNBA is acknowledged not just for its athletic accomplishments however likewise for its function in social activism and gender equality.

Key Highlights

Growth in Viewership: The WNBA has actually seen increased tv scores, thanks to much better media protection and strategic collaborations.
Social Impact: WNBA gamers have actually been singing advocates for social justice, which has amassed the league significant attention and support.
Revenue: While the WNBA's income is still modest compared to the NBA, it is growing progressively, showing increasing business sponsorships and fan engagement.

MMA: The Knockout Success of Combat Sports

Blended Martial Arts (MMA), led by the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C), continues to grow in appeal, with 17% of Americans identifying as fans. MMA's appeal lies in its high-intensity action and the worldwide nature of its competitors.

Secret Highlights

Profits and Viewership: The UFC is one of the most lucrative sports organizations globally, with an organization design heavily dependent on pay-per-view events.
Worldwide Appeal: MMA brings in a varied fanbase, with fighters from various nations bringing their unique designs to the octagon.
Cultural Influence: MMA's increase has actually been sustained by its attract younger audiences and its prominence on social media platforms.
